framing (20170906)

September 6, 2017 crow11 Comments

this is a window
but you think
you are outside

i pull you back
until you see
the frame
the sill
the sudden reflection
of light on glass
your own ghost
like pigment transferred to acetate
marbled, colorful, but hardly there
a film’s second exposure
and through that the world

you think you see
with your eyes

Poem 20160330

March 30, 2016March 30, 2016 crow

temporary blindness
transient invisibility
brought on by mirrors

obscured
out of line
shuddering iris
flickering sight
collapsing retina

you see the room
behind you
your clothes
but never yourself

sometimes the you were
never the you are
